Ah'sya Vietnamese Restaurant is highly regarded for its authentic Vietnamese dishes, particularly the pho. Many patrons appreciate the warm, family-operated atmosphere, though occasional lapses in service have been noted. Overall, it’s considered a gem in the heart of St. George for anyone looking for genuine Vietnamese food.
